Output 7a57f654e2274053d74b3118b0eaff116206eb77bf3caab3e01409f136603926:3

value
308661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bbc632253e500aec9bf67c99cc0a54cb093d220 OP_EQUAL
address
378sUEgxdR7fm7Je2iNTyczPJ7Wmv2rcNb
transaction
7a57f654e2274053d74b3118b0eaff116206eb77bf3caab3e01409f136603926